Hyderabad: With the monsoon season approaching, Cyberabad police and municipal authorities initiated ground-level inspections to prevent waterlogging and traffic disruptions across vulnerable stretches in the city.

Cyberabad commissioner Dr M. Ramesh, along with CMC commissioner Srujana, conducted a joint field inspection of flood-prone locations under the commissionerate on Wednesday. The visit focused on identifying areas vulnerable to water stagnation during heavy rains and ensuring preventive measures are implemented before the onset of intense rainfall.

Senior officials from engineering and civic departments accompanied the team to assess recurring problem points and find permanent solutions to minimise the inconvenience to commuters.

Among the key locations inspected was the stretch near Care Hospital at Biodiversity Junction, adjacent to Malkam Cheruvu, where heavy rain frequently leads to flooding on roads, resulting in severe traffic congestion. Officials also visited the Hyderabad Central University Road and the Harsha Toyota showroom junction in Kondapur, both identified as vulnerable spots for rainwater accumulation during monsoon spells.

During the inspection, officials stressed the need for coordinated efforts among municipal authorities, police and engineering departments to ensure uninterrupted traffic movement and public convenience during the rainy season. The identification of vulnerable locations and timely intervention would help prevent major traffic snarls and reduce inconvenience to the public.

Officials added that measures were being planned to ensure water does not stagnate on roads, particularly in high-traffic corridors of the IT hub.

Sherilingampally Zonal Commissioner Narayana Amit, Kukatpally DCP Rith Raj, ADCP Hanumantha Rao and other officials participated in the inspection.
